Biography

Clairo is the stage name for singer-songwriter Claire Cottrill, whose song “Pretty Girl” went viral in late 2017 on YouTube. She is the daughter of Geoff Cottrill, a famous marketer who held high-ranking positions at Converse, Coca-Cola, and Procter & Gamble.
